Job Summary 

Villagio Hospitality Group is growing! We are seeking talented and passionate Cooks to join our award-winning team at The Black Sheep Restaurant. If you’re a culinary professional who thrives in a fast-paced, high-energy kitchen and is dedicated to delivering exceptional dining experiences, we want you on our team!

The Cook prepares food/menu items for guest consumption, utilizing only approved recipes, cooking methods and ingredients as set by Food & Beverage/Culinary Management. Maintains all food, equipment and kitchens to be in compliance with all health codes and Villagio Hospitality standards. Maintains a positive, team-oriented and accommodating attitude toward guests (internal as well as external), fellow team members and management, at all times. Operates in representation of the culinary team’s best in class culture, while championing the goals and priorities of The Black Sheep in a manner that reflects and upholds Villagio’s vision, mission and values.

PRIMARY R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Prepare and cook meals across our diverse range of food outlets, ensuring consistent quality and presentation.
  • Understand and follow recipes and presentation specifications as set by the executive chef.
  • Maintain cleanliness and comply with food sanitation requirements by properly handling food and ensuring correct storage.
  • Operate a variety of kitchen equipment safely and efficiently.
  • Manage time effectively to meet service, prep, and cleaning expectations.
  • Assists in food prep and any other duties per business needs
  • Assist in the development of menu items and daily specials.
  • Work collaboratively with the kitchen team to ensure smooth operations and guest satisfaction.
  • Adhere to all company policies and procedures, including health and safety standards.
